They contend that education contributes two kinds of functions: manifest (or primary) functions, which are the intended and visible functions of education; and latent (or secondary) functions, which are the hidden and unintended functions. Manifest functions are meant to occur and meant to be recognized, while latent functions are unrecognized and unintended. Latent functions of an institution may (1) support the manifest function, (2) be irrelevant, or (3) may even undermine manifest functions. Latent functions include child care, the establishment of peer relationships, and lowering unemployment by keeping high school students out of the full-time labor force. Manifest functions are the known and intended results of a social pattern.
